I'll start off with a change from the usual burgers and sausages and introduce some tasty mains and sides, but of course the first step is to light your charcoal BBQ at least an hour before you want to start cooking.

Arrange the coals in a stack in the centre of the BBQ pit.

Place kindling around the base and a firelighter to get it started.

Once the coals have caught, you can spread them out and leave them to turn to ash - this is the time to start cooking.

I also like to add some mesquite wood chips for added flavour.

If you need to top up the coals, add them around the edge and allow them to burn down before introducing them to the main fire pit.

Main dishes:

Prawn and Shrimp skewers.

Salmon marinated with chili and lime.

Cowboy Caviar, you must try this. Link to recipe on web https://www.easyanddelish.com/texas-caviar-recipe/

and finally a nice peachslaw....

Start with the usual coleslaw receipe and add bell peppers, fresh mint, chopped nuts and peach chunks
